Synopsis of El niño-jazz
"El niño-jazz" es una colección de poemas de Mohammed Dib que exploran la inocencia y la sorpresa a través de los ojos de un niño. La poesía, similar al jazz, respira libremente entre palabras y sentimientos improvisados, invitando a los lectores a redescubrir la belleza en lo cotidiano y a recordar la capacidad de asombro que reside en la infancia. Esta edición en tapa blanda, publicada por Bassarai Ediciones, consta de 160 páginas y ofrece una experiencia lírica que celebra la vida y la poesía.
